Well I think individual expectations (at least) depend in some measure upon whether or not one is for Jackson's The Lord of the Rings, especially if he becomes the director (if it is not already confirmed that is).

I always thought that The Hobbit was going to be 'enough' like Jackson's Lord of the Rings no matter who directed it, because Jackson's beast is still too big to be ignored by those who have no reason to ignore it -- I mean, there's no arguing it didn't make a lot of money and win awards, regardless of opinions of how faithful or unfaithful an adaptation it is. I guess it's quite possible that someone would put up a ton of money to back a director who intended to wholly disregard Jackson's The Lord of the Rings, but I think it's unlikely, at this point anyway.




For myself I don't like Jackson's style of making films (my opinion here includes King Kong). I don't agree with him concerning what he (apparently) thinks is good filmmaking -- and I think he and his writing team all too often put their own ideas of what is 'good', or their own ideas concerning what audiences today will or will not accept, over Tolkien's tale and its spirit and tone.

So while anything is possible, do I generally expect to like these Hobbit films? No.


I'm sure plenty of people expect to like or love them however, because they like or love what Jackson has already done.
